If there has been a considerable period of time between completion of chemotherapy and recurrence/progression, a return to the prior chemotherapy regimen may be employed. Although radiation was frequently viewed as a one-time treatment, given newer approaches to radiation targeting that is more efficient at sparing normal brain, re-irradiation has become more commonplace if sufficient time has passed since the initial treatment. At all stages of treatment, consideration of enrollment to a clinical trial should be given in patients who are interested and meet eligibility criteria. As with diffuse astrocytoma, the first step in management of anaplastic astrocytoma is surgical. This can be biopsy, for the sake of establishing a diagnosis, in the situation in which the primary lesion is in an area where a more extensive surgical resection will result in permanent neurologic impairment, or if there are other underlying comorbidities that would make a more extensive surgical resection contraindicated. Often, at the time of surgical resection, the differential includes all grades of astrocytoma, and anaplastic, oligodendroglial, and mixed histologies; and given the heterogeneity of these tumors, a more limited biopsy is prone to sampling bias, as the grade of the tumor is determined by the highest grade features identified within the tumor, which may not be recognized with a limited sample. Presently, there is no standard treatment for anaplastic astrocytoma, and approaches are generally extrapolated from data generated from trials performed in malignant glioma (anaplastic astrocytoma, anaplastic oligodendroglioma, anaplastic oligoastroctyoma, and glioblastoma), or from trials specific to glioblastoma. Fractionated radiation to 60 Gy is a standard radiation treatment for malignant glioma, and is a common first step to treatment in anaplastic astrocytoma. Onset is typically in adulthood, and the cerebral hemispheres are the most common location giving rise to these tumors. The majority arise de novo as glioblastoma, though a small percent undergoes malignant progression from a lower grade tumor. They are invasive by nature, limiting the curative potential of surgical approaches. Traditional radiation and chemotherapeutic approaches result in a median survival of 14 to 16 months. The clinical presentation in patients diagnosed with glioblastoma is very heterogeneous, depending on the location and size of the tumor and the extent of associated edema. Seizure, headache, confusion, somnolence, gait dysfunction, focal weakness, coordination changes, visual disturbance, and memory issues are frequent presenting symptoms. Rapid onset in people over 50, especially in the absence of a prior headache history, should raise concern for more than a benign headache. Headaches that become progressively more frequent and severe over time, with decreasing benefit of analgesic medication, should also raise suspicion, especially in the setting of a unilateral headache that does not alternate sides of the head. Progressive focal symptoms, such as sensory or motor dysfunction, or accompanying cognitive or behavioral symptoms also suggest tumor as an underlying etiology for the headache. Language and motor difficulties often occur in dominant hemisphere frontal lesions.

The incidence of Dravet syndrome is 1:40,000 and it occurs more often in boys than girls, with a ratio of 2:1. Affected children typically present with generalized or unilateral prolonged febrile seizures initially. Seizures are often photosensitive, being an additional indicator for a poor prognosis. Sleep architecture remains initially preserved in most children, but as seizures tend to become nocturnal in older children and adults, it is not surprising that epileptiform abnormalities may appear during sleep as well. Psychomotor development stagnates around the second year of life, resulting in severe intellectual disability and progressive cognitive decline as well as ataxia. Although about one-third of families have a history of febrile seizures and epilepsy, 95% of mutations associated with this syndrome arise de novo. The most prominent feature is an acquired aphasia that typically entails severe impairment of speech comprehension and production, which may eventually result in mutism. Approximately 75% to 80% of the patients develop clinical seizures; however, it is rarely severe and about one-third will only have one lifetime episode. Commonly, nocturnal simple partial seizures, complex partial seizures with psychomotor automatisms, generalized tonic-clonic seizures, atypical absence, and rarely myoclonic-astatic or tonic seizures are seen. Long-term outcomes range from complete recovery to severe aphasia with the majority of patients experiencing residual language deficits.
